Electrostatic PVC is a form of Polyvinyl Chloride that has been enhanced to generate static electricity. This static property allows the material to attract dust and dirt, making it an excellent choice for products designed to keep environments clean. The unique combination of durability and flexibility makes it highly sought after in industries ranging from cleaning to automotive.

As research and development continue to expand, new applications for electrostatic PVC are emerging. Future uses may include more advanced solutions for electronic packaging, enhanced cleaning products, and applications in new sectors like aerospace and renewable energy.
